India can whip Australia 3-1, predicts Sehwag

October 6, 2008

NEW DELHI (AFP) - India could thrash Australia 3-1 in the upcoming Test series if it is played on turning pitches, opener Virender Sehwag said on Monday.

"If we play on spin-friendly tracks, the series might go 3-1 in our favour," the hard-hitting Indian batsman told CNN-IBN news channel.

"India is the only team that beat Australia in Australia twice. We beat them in Perth last time and before that in Adelaide.

"So we are accepting the challenge and we will fight it out. Hopefully, we will do well and reclaim the Border-Gavaskar Trophy."

Of the 22 Tests played for the Trophy, Australia have won 10 and India eight, with four draws.
